The pediatrics unit at BroMenn Regional Medical Center is for children who need specialized care and extra-special attention. And we're here for parents, too. We call it Family-Centered Care. Our team of exceptionally skilled and extraordinarily devoted caregivers are easy to talk to and good at helping kids and their families adjust to unfamiliar routines and surroundings.

Although the pediatric unit is on the fourth floor, our staff cares for junior patients throughout the hospital. We help out in the emergency department, lab and X-ray departments, same-day surgery and all the other places where children are cared for.

Experts tell us that art is therapeutic. Our junior patients tell us that the murals and decorations in our pediatric rooms are cool. Kids enter imaginary worlds that include a jungle, tree house, circus, fairy tales and a toy store. Other room themes are the beach, crayons, sports, a farm and fish. Each room also has a telephone and a TV/VCR. A video game system and games are available on request.

Hospital Visits

A child's hospital stay can be stressful for everyone in the family. We provide recliners or cots for sleeping, and encourage parents to be with their child as much as possible. A designated adult friend or relative can stay as well, and brothers and sisters can stay for short visits. All visitors, however, must be free of fever and/or other symptoms. A child's favorite toys, blankets or other precious items that represent security and familiar surroundings may be brought to the hospital.
